    Purge (priming) Pump quick test

    Is the ink level of your color cartridges go down after a few cleaning cycles? If yes, the ink was sucked from the cartridges through the inlet screen, internal ink channels and nozzles down to the purge pads. Put some Windex on the inlet screens and do a nozzle check.
